All bleeds are physical damage. No bleeds are reduced by armor. As long as its coded like a bleed it likely wont be reduced by armor because that would be double dipping armor.

The set bonuses seem pretty decent on paper. They arent on PTR so we cant playtest them yet and we dont have any info on how they are supposed to work. The two most likely outcomes I can see are these.

1: Soul rip is a single target dot caused by ALL damage you deal. Meaning BF damage counts towards it but it stacks up on one target. This would lead to a “funnel” style where 5% of all our BF damage is getting stacked up on your main target, which would be pretty strong.

2: Soul rip is simply a dot on anything you do damage to, including BF targets. Casting BtE consumes them all to “burst” their damage. This one seems like the most likely to me.

The important interactions that need testing (as some people have said) are whether or not damage procs/trinkets count towards it. Outlaw is a spec that tends to leverage big on use trinkets and damage procs.

Also whether or not the BtE damage that explodes the soul rend adds to a new soul rip effect or is calculated in the old soul rip before it bursts. Depending on this talents like imp BtE might not be very good because a majority of their soul rips damage value will have expired by the time you get to the next BtE cast.

Personally I think its a fine set. A bit boring, outlaws damage pattern is too flat for us to “abuse” the ignite like mechanic of 2set and stack up a big one to BtE off. Pretty much the only world where we can do something like this is if direct damage trinkets add to the DoT.

  1. doesn’t work with trinkets
  2. It’s currently doing 5% of damage done every SECOND for the 2 piece. I expected it to be over 8 seconds. kind of busted. [Bug]
  3. works with bladeflurry. Does not funnel.
  4. BTE pops all 2 piece on every mob
  5. soul reave does not apply the DOT back on targets that originally had a Dot
    IE, bladeflurry two mobs and then cancel bladeflurry. Press BTE, 4 piece procs and then the previous two no longer have a dot.
  6. BTE damage is applied for a new DOT
  7. 4 piece does not stack the agility buff
  8. Seems to snapshot the damage on the target? Once you damage a target and walk away, it doesn’t lower without new damage instances. [Bug]
    9 ) 4 piece is only doing damage based on the DOT tick, not the the entire amount of damage remaining [Bug]
4 Likes

It gets amped by prey on the weak as well. Seems only interacts with damage applied to the target.
not affected by haste or other stat buffs you gain. IE, bloodlust doesn’t help the already on the target dots.

So to clear up some confusion about what you are seeing, it is “working” correctly with initial damage calculations but it has some weird interactions with buffs/debuffs.

So 2set is double dipping armor. It echos 5% of damage reduced by armor (since 99% of our damage is physical) and then the dot itself is reduced by armor again. This is making it do less damage then it seems like it should, it should realistically be ~3.5% of your dps.

2set also double dips the damage amp from ghostly strike and double dips FW armor cut but double dipping armor is far more costly to its overall damage so these dont outweigh that.

4set is currently calculating its damage based on 1 tick of the dot, not the entire dot (it was doing this with the old bugged 2set as well they just never fixed it). 4 set also double dips vers and double dips crit so when its bug fixed it will probably be decent.
